Surat : APMC Under BJP MLA’s Leadership Accused of Flouting Construction Laws at Sardar Market

Surat: The Agriculture Produce Market Committee (APMC) in Surat, led by newly appointed chairman and BJP MLA from Choriyasi assembly seat, Sandip Desai, has come under scrutiny for allegedly disregarding the law of the land. Accusations have been raised that the APMC is constructing facilities at the Sardar Market without obtaining the necessary construction permissions from the Surat Municipal Corporation’s (SMC) Town planning department.

The Sardar Market, which falls under the jurisdiction of the SMC, has been operating under the APMC’s management. Despite this, the APMC reportedly initiated construction activities at the market without seeking proper authorization from the town planning department.

Former Congress councilor, Aslam Cyclewala, has brought this matter to the attention of top SMC authorities, highlighting the potential dangers of unauthorized construction at the site. In his communication, Cyclewala posed serious questions to the authorities regarding the accountability of both the APMC and the SMC if any unfortunate accidents occur during the ongoing construction.

The alleged lack of adherence to legal procedures by the APMC has raised concerns among citizens and the local community. As an elected representative and chairman of APMC, Sandip Desai’s leadership has come under scrutiny for what appears to be an open license to violate laws without repercussions.

Construction activities at the Sardar Market are said to be in full swing, despite the absence of the requisite permissions. Such actions have raised eyebrows and questions about the APMC’s conduct and whether they are above the law.

When approached for a statement, Sandip Desai’s office did not respond immediately. However, Aslam Cyclewala expressed deep concern over the potential consequences of the unauthorized construction, stating, “Public safety should always be the top priority, and no entity, not even the APMC, should be allowed to proceed without adhering to the law.”

Meanwhile, the SMC has assured a thorough investigation into the matter. A senior official from the Town planning department stated, “We have received information about the alleged illegal construction at Sardar Market. Our team will conduct a comprehensive inquiry and take appropriate action based on the findings.”

The incident has sparked debates within the political circles of Surat, with opposition parties demanding accountability and urging the APMC and its chairman to be held responsible for any violations committed during the construction.
